Дисплей lshw -C показывает НЕПРАВИЛЬНО для графической карты GT840M

9

Я всегда пытался установить драйверы для NVIDIA и заставить его работать, но мой ноутбук все еще настаивает на использовании интегрированного графического процессора Intel Haswell.

Вот что я пробовал до сих пор:

Сначала я попытался установить последние драйверы от графических осушителей PPA:

sudo apt-add-repository ppa:graphics-drivers/ppa
sudo apt-get update
sudo apt-get install nvidia-367 

Я надеялся, что он может заставить мою видеокарту работать, но это не так.

Затем я скачал .runфайл с официального веб-сайта nVidia, но этот установщик выдает мне сообщение: «Сценарий предустановки, поставляемый с дистрибутивом, не выполнен!» ошибка. До сих пор не знаю, почему это дает мне такую ​​ошибку.

Последнее, что я попробовал, было после установки nvidia-367:

sudo apt-get install nvidia-prime
sudo prime-select nvidia
reboot

Как вы можете догадаться, это тоже не сработало. sudo lshw -C displayКоманда дает мне следующий вывод:

  *-display               
       description: VGA compatible controller
       product: Haswell-ULT Integrated Graphics Controller
       vendor: Intel Corporation
       physical id: 2
       bus info: pci@0000:00:02.0
       version: 0b
       width: 64 bits
       clock: 33MHz
       capabilities: msi pm vga_controller bus_master cap_list rom
       configuration: driver=i915 latency=0
       resources: irq:43 memory:b5000000-b53fffff memory:c0000000-cfffffff ioport:6000(size=64)
  *-display UNCLAIMED
       description: 3D controller
       product: GM108M [GeForce 840M]
       vendor: NVIDIA Corporation
       physical id: 0
       bus info: pci@0000:0a:00.0
       version: a2
       width: 64 bits
       clock: 33MHz
       capabilities: pm msi pciexpress bus_master cap_list
       configuration: latency=0
       resources: memory:b3000000-b3ffffff memory:a0000000-afffffff memory:b0000000-b1ffffff ioport:3000(size=128)

Я использую Ubuntu 16.04 и моя видеокарта nVidia GT 840M

emreaydin149
источник
Возможно, вам нужно отключить безопасную загрузку в BIOS.
Pilot6
OMFG, спасибо человеку, это работало как волшебство. Если бы я был с тобой в одной стране, я бы в ту же ночь поехал к тебе домой и обнял тебя, пока ты не покакаешь. Еще раз спасибо! (не гей)
emreaydin149

Ответы:

5

Безопасная загрузка не позволяет nvidiaзагружать модуль.

Отключите безопасную загрузку в BIOS, и это должно быть решено.

Вы можете увидеть этот вопрос для получения дополнительной информации.

Pilot6
источник
14
Это не решило это для меня, к сожалению. Уже отключили, но все еще не востребованы.
Зельфир Кальцталь